摘要
利用1998年12月~1999年1月在南岭山地进行的雾的综合野外观测资料,分析了南岭山地浓雾的宏、微观物理特征;对三次典型浓雾过程的谱特征、含水量与能见度的关系进行了分析、讨论;指出南岭山地的浓雾过程与天气系统的活动密切相关。
By using the composite field observational data of fog at Nanling mountain area from Dec.1998 to Jan.1999, the macro and microphysics characteristics of dense fog were analyzed, especially the relationship of fog spectra, water content, and visibility of three fog processes were analyzed in detail. The paper points out that the dense fog processes that occurred at Nanling mountain area were closely related with the weather system.
